Einige Fragen zum Thema Prozessticket
Einige Fragen zum Thema Prozessticket
Hallo liebe Community,
es hat den Anschein, als ob ich zu dämlich wäre um ein Prozessticket in OTRS zu erstellen. Bei mir will das Programm vorne und hinten nicht wie ich es gerne hätte .
Ich würde gerne ein Formular erstellen, welches einige Werte abfragt (z.B. Name, Vorname, etc.). Dieses Formular soll in einem weiteren Schritt dann in ein Ticket verfasst werden und einer bestimmten Queue und einem bestimmten Mitarbeiter zugeordnet werden. Das ist zunächst alles was ich machen will^^.
Um das Formular erst einmal mit Felder füllen zu können, muss ich zunächst DynamicFields erstellen. Von welchem Aktionen müssen die DynamicFields sein damit sie erst in den Formular zu sehen sind und später in dem Ticket? Doch wahrscheinlich von der Aktion "Ticket" und im Fall vom DynamicField_Name in Form von Text, oder (siehe screenshot "Name")?
In einem nächsten Schritt müsste ich doch dann bestimmt unter "Admin" -> "Systemverwaltung" -> "Prozess-Management" einen neuen Prozess anlegen der zwei Aktivitäten beinhaltet und einen Übergang dazwischen (siehe screenshot "Prozess")?!
Der ersten Aktivität muss man einen Aktivitätsdialog zuordnen welchem wiederum ein DynamicField zugeordnet ist (siehe "Aktivitäts-Dialog").
Fehlen tun dann doch nur noch die beiden Übergangs-Aktionen (siehe screenshot "Besitzer" und "Übergangs-Aktion: Queue").
Wenn ich das alles gespeichert und syncronisiert habe, dann habe ich immer noch kein Besitzerwechsel und kein Queuewechsel. Außerdem wird mein Formular in dem Ticket über einen Button angehängt, die ausgefüllten DynamicFields werden nicht direkt unter den Prozessinformationen angezeigt.
Kann mir jemand helfen? Ich sitze gefühlt eine Ewigkeit an diesem Prozess, obwohl er eigentlich echt simpel ist.
PS: Der Prozess ist dann noch lange nicht fertig aber der erste Schritt zu einem vollkommenden Prozess wäre ersteinmal getan
es hat den Anschein, als ob ich zu dämlich wäre um ein Prozessticket in OTRS zu erstellen. Bei mir will das Programm vorne und hinten nicht wie ich es gerne hätte .
Ich würde gerne ein Formular erstellen, welches einige Werte abfragt (z.B. Name, Vorname, etc.). Dieses Formular soll in einem weiteren Schritt dann in ein Ticket verfasst werden und einer bestimmten Queue und einem bestimmten Mitarbeiter zugeordnet werden. Das ist zunächst alles was ich machen will^^.
Um das Formular erst einmal mit Felder füllen zu können, muss ich zunächst DynamicFields erstellen. Von welchem Aktionen müssen die DynamicFields sein damit sie erst in den Formular zu sehen sind und später in dem Ticket? Doch wahrscheinlich von der Aktion "Ticket" und im Fall vom DynamicField_Name in Form von Text, oder (siehe screenshot "Name")?
In einem nächsten Schritt müsste ich doch dann bestimmt unter "Admin" -> "Systemverwaltung" -> "Prozess-Management" einen neuen Prozess anlegen der zwei Aktivitäten beinhaltet und einen Übergang dazwischen (siehe screenshot "Prozess")?!
Der ersten Aktivität muss man einen Aktivitätsdialog zuordnen welchem wiederum ein DynamicField zugeordnet ist (siehe "Aktivitäts-Dialog").
Fehlen tun dann doch nur noch die beiden Übergangs-Aktionen (siehe screenshot "Besitzer" und "Übergangs-Aktion: Queue").
Wenn ich das alles gespeichert und syncronisiert habe, dann habe ich immer noch kein Besitzerwechsel und kein Queuewechsel. Außerdem wird mein Formular in dem Ticket über einen Button angehängt, die ausgefüllten DynamicFields werden nicht direkt unter den Prozessinformationen angezeigt.
Kann mir jemand helfen? Ich sitze gefühlt eine Ewigkeit an diesem Prozess, obwohl er eigentlich echt simpel ist.
PS: Der Prozess ist dann noch lange nicht fertig aber der erste Schritt zu einem vollkommenden Prozess wäre ersteinmal getan
You do not have the required permissions to view the files attached to this post.
Re: Einige Fragen zum Thema Prozessticket
Hier die beiden fehlenden screenshots^^.
You do not have the required permissions to view the files attached to this post.
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Super Paint Zeichnungen
Also, meine Vorschläge:
1) Du willst die Queue setzen mit dem Modul TicketOwnerSet, stell das mal um auf TicketQueueSet
2) Der Key in der TransitionAction Besitzerwechsel ist klein geschrieben, änder das mal auf groß (owner -> Owner)
3) Stelle sicher dass eine Queue "test" und ein benutzer "test" bestehen - oder nimm realdaten - oder track den apache log nebenher
4) Eine Transitionaction kann nur feuern wenn die Transition feuert -> was sind deine Übergangsfilter? Und denk drann das Transitions nur ausgeführt werden wenn Änderungen am Ticket vorgenommen wurden -> brav ein neues Ticket aufmachen, oder per Aktivitätsdialog Werte ändern.
Also, meine Vorschläge:
1) Du willst die Queue setzen mit dem Modul TicketOwnerSet, stell das mal um auf TicketQueueSet
2) Der Key in der TransitionAction Besitzerwechsel ist klein geschrieben, änder das mal auf groß (owner -> Owner)
3) Stelle sicher dass eine Queue "test" und ein benutzer "test" bestehen - oder nimm realdaten - oder track den apache log nebenher
4) Eine Transitionaction kann nur feuern wenn die Transition feuert -> was sind deine Übergangsfilter? Und denk drann das Transitions nur ausgeführt werden wenn Änderungen am Ticket vorgenommen wurden -> brav ein neues Ticket aufmachen, oder per Aktivitätsdialog Werte ändern.
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Hi,
Mein Vorschlag wäre, dass Du dir mal den Beispielprozess einmal baust
http://otrs.github.io/doc/manual/admin/ ... ement.html
Dort sind die Grundlagen erklärt.
für Deine Übergangsaktionen solltest du neben RStraub Antwort auch http://otrs.github.io/doc/manual/admin/ ... on-actions lesen
Du solltest auch OTRS Admin Wissen mitbringen (was Du ja anscheinend tust) dann dürfte das klappen.
Achso, ja... Wie RStraub schreibt: das ist alles case sensitive. ein 'owner' funktioniert in der TransistionAction TicketOwnerSet nicht. Es muss 'Owner' sein.
Flo
Mein Vorschlag wäre, dass Du dir mal den Beispielprozess einmal baust
http://otrs.github.io/doc/manual/admin/ ... ement.html
Dort sind die Grundlagen erklärt.
für Deine Übergangsaktionen solltest du neben RStraub Antwort auch http://otrs.github.io/doc/manual/admin/ ... on-actions lesen
Du solltest auch OTRS Admin Wissen mitbringen (was Du ja anscheinend tust) dann dürfte das klappen.
Achso, ja... Wie RStraub schreibt: das ist alles case sensitive. ein 'owner' funktioniert in der TransistionAction TicketOwnerSet nicht. Es muss 'Owner' sein.
Flo
OTRS 8 SILVER (Prod)
OTRS 8 auf Debian 11 (Test)
Znuny 7.x latest version testing auf Debian 11
-- Ich beantworte keine Forums-Fragen PN - No PN please
I won't answer to unfriendly users any more. A greeting and regards are just polite.
OTRS 8 auf Debian 11 (Test)
Znuny 7.x latest version testing auf Debian 11
-- Ich beantworte keine Forums-Fragen PN - No PN please
I won't answer to unfriendly users any more. A greeting and regards are just polite.
Re: Einige Fragen zum Thema Prozessticket
Okay, ich bin schon mal einen Schritt weiter gekommen, nachdem ich den Beispielprozess gebaut hatte. Nichts desto trotz fehlen mir immer noch viele Kenntnisse, damit ich mir einen Prozess nach belieben zusammenwurschteln kann.
Meine nächste Frage wäre deshalb:
Wie sieht ein Übergang zu einer nächsten Aktivität aus, wenn ich prüfen will, ob ein Kontrollkästchen markiert ist oder nicht?
Meine nächste Frage wäre deshalb:
Wie sieht ein Übergang zu einer nächsten Aktivität aus, wenn ich prüfen will, ob ein Kontrollkästchen markiert ist oder nicht?
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Prüfe auf Wert 0 oder 1.
0 ist dabei "nicht selektiert".
0 ist dabei "nicht selektiert".
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Der Übergang vom Typ String?
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Jawohl
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Hi,
ist es nicht Checked und Unchecked?
Flo
ist es nicht Checked und Unchecked?
Flo
OTRS 8 SILVER (Prod)
OTRS 8 auf Debian 11 (Test)
Znuny 7.x latest version testing auf Debian 11
-- Ich beantworte keine Forums-Fragen PN - No PN please
I won't answer to unfriendly users any more. A greeting and regards are just polite.
OTRS 8 auf Debian 11 (Test)
Znuny 7.x latest version testing auf Debian 11
-- Ich beantworte keine Forums-Fragen PN - No PN please
I won't answer to unfriendly users any more. A greeting and regards are just polite.
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Grad nochmal getestet - 0 / 1 funktioniert auf jeden Fall, ist auch so in der DB abgelegt.
Evtl. wird im Modul selbst auch auf checked / unchecked geprüft.
Evtl. wird im Modul selbst auch auf checked / unchecked geprüft.
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Hallo mal wieder^^,
die Funktion mit den Checkboxen werde ich bei nächster Gelegenheit testen. Bis dahin benötige ich allerdings noch eine andere Funktion im Prozessmanagement:
Wie kann ich das erste Formular um die Felder eines zweiten Formulars erweitern (ich habe mal versucht mein Problem zu illustrieren^^).
die Funktion mit den Checkboxen werde ich bei nächster Gelegenheit testen. Bis dahin benötige ich allerdings noch eine andere Funktion im Prozessmanagement:
Wie kann ich das erste Formular um die Felder eines zweiten Formulars erweitern (ich habe mal versucht mein Problem zu illustrieren^^).
You do not have the required permissions to view the files attached to this post.
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Gar nicht. Das benötigt einen neuen Aktivitätsdialog mit all den Feldern die drin sein sollen.
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Das ist schade, dass das nicht funktioniert.
Wie kann ich denn das 1. Formular als solches in diesem Prozessticket stehen lassen und ein neues Formular im selben Prozessticket erzeugen?
Wie kann ich denn das 1. Formular als solches in diesem Prozessticket stehen lassen und ein neues Formular im selben Prozessticket erzeugen?
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Das verstehe ich nicht.
Ich nehme an was du Formular nennst ist ein OTRS-Aktivitätsdialog. Davon kannst du im Prozess-Management beliebig viele erzeugen und jeder Aktivität beliebig viele zuordnen.
Ich nehme an was du Formular nennst ist ein OTRS-Aktivitätsdialog. Davon kannst du im Prozess-Management beliebig viele erzeugen und jeder Aktivität beliebig viele zuordnen.
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Kann sein das ich da auch was nicht verstehe
Du hast aber schon recht, dass "mein Formular" ein Aktivitäts-Dialog ist. Wenn ich den Aktivitätsdialog (Formular 1, siehe Illustration zuvor) an ein Agenten meines Systems weiterleite um eine Entscheidung zu treffen (Entscheidung), dann erhalte ich eine unveränderbare Übersicht über die gemachten Angaben im ersten Aktivitäts-Dialog (Formular 1).
Wie ist der nächste Übergang zu machen, dass ich weitere eingaben in einem neuen Aktivitäts-Dialog (Formular 2) machen kann? Das kann in dem Fall ja keine einfache Weiterleitung nehmen, so wie ich es eigentlich vor hatte
Grüße
Du hast aber schon recht, dass "mein Formular" ein Aktivitäts-Dialog ist. Wenn ich den Aktivitätsdialog (Formular 1, siehe Illustration zuvor) an ein Agenten meines Systems weiterleite um eine Entscheidung zu treffen (Entscheidung), dann erhalte ich eine unveränderbare Übersicht über die gemachten Angaben im ersten Aktivitäts-Dialog (Formular 1).
Wie ist der nächste Übergang zu machen, dass ich weitere eingaben in einem neuen Aktivitäts-Dialog (Formular 2) machen kann? Das kann in dem Fall ja keine einfache Weiterleitung nehmen, so wie ich es eigentlich vor hatte
Grüße
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Dein Problem ist also dass du nicht weißt auf der Übergang reagieren soll?
Du könntest dir ein dyn. Feld vom Typ Checkbox oder Dropdown machen und mit nur zwei Werten ausstatten. Dem Aktivitätsdialog zur Entscheidung fügst du dann dieses Feld (nicht sichtbar) hinzu, und belegst es mit einem Standardwert.
Diese wird nun immer gesetzt wenn eine Entscheidung getroffen wird und auf den kannst du dann auch für den nächsten Übergang filtern.
Du könntest dir ein dyn. Feld vom Typ Checkbox oder Dropdown machen und mit nur zwei Werten ausstatten. Dem Aktivitätsdialog zur Entscheidung fügst du dann dieses Feld (nicht sichtbar) hinzu, und belegst es mit einem Standardwert.
Diese wird nun immer gesetzt wenn eine Entscheidung getroffen wird und auf den kannst du dann auch für den nächsten Übergang filtern.
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Ich erkläre einfach mal, was ich vor im allgemeinen vor habe.
Die Thematik dreht sich eigentlich um die Erstellung eines neuen Mitarbeiters. Ich möchte das die Personalabteilung einen ersten Aktivitäts-Dialog (ich nenne diesen Formular) ausfühlt, in dem erste Personaldaten erfasst werden. In einem weiteren Schritt steht die Entscheidung an, ob die gemachten Angaben zur Kenntnis genommen werden, oder ob weitere Daten erfragt werden müssen (Entscheidung). Im Falle der zur Kenntnisnahme soll das Ticket geschlossen werden. Im Falle der weiteren Datenabfrage sollen die Daten, die durch die Personalabteilung eingetragen wurden durch erweiterte, von mich gemachte, dynamsiche Felder ergänzt werden. So hatte ich mir das jedenfalls vorgestellt... Das soll auch noch nicht das Ende des Prozesses sein aber die ersten Schritte des noch größer werdenden Projekts^^.
Es geht jetzt um die Ergänzungen die ich machen will
Die Thematik dreht sich eigentlich um die Erstellung eines neuen Mitarbeiters. Ich möchte das die Personalabteilung einen ersten Aktivitäts-Dialog (ich nenne diesen Formular) ausfühlt, in dem erste Personaldaten erfasst werden. In einem weiteren Schritt steht die Entscheidung an, ob die gemachten Angaben zur Kenntnis genommen werden, oder ob weitere Daten erfragt werden müssen (Entscheidung). Im Falle der zur Kenntnisnahme soll das Ticket geschlossen werden. Im Falle der weiteren Datenabfrage sollen die Daten, die durch die Personalabteilung eingetragen wurden durch erweiterte, von mich gemachte, dynamsiche Felder ergänzt werden. So hatte ich mir das jedenfalls vorgestellt... Das soll auch noch nicht das Ende des Prozesses sein aber die ersten Schritte des noch größer werdenden Projekts^^.
Es geht jetzt um die Ergänzungen die ich machen will
-
- Znuny guru
- Posts: 2210
- Joined: 13 Mar 2014, 09:16
- Znuny Version: 6.0.14
- Real Name: Rolf Straub
Re: Einige Fragen zum Thema Prozessticket
Ja aber... wo ist das Problem ?!
Erstell dir einen Aktivitätsdialog mit den "Ergänzungen" und pack den in eine Aktivität rein.
Erstell dir einen Aktivitätsdialog mit den "Ergänzungen" und pack den in eine Aktivität rein.
Currently using: OTRS 6.0.14 -- MariaDB -- Ubuntu 16 LTS
Re: Einige Fragen zum Thema Prozessticket
Hi,
... oder Du gehst mal auf 'ne Schulung Da kriegst alles erklärt. Die Sachen im Forum
zu klären ist schon ganz schön heftig
Flo
... oder Du gehst mal auf 'ne Schulung Da kriegst alles erklärt. Die Sachen im Forum
zu klären ist schon ganz schön heftig
Flo
OTRS 8 SILVER (Prod)
OTRS 8 auf Debian 11 (Test)
Znuny 7.x latest version testing auf Debian 11
-- Ich beantworte keine Forums-Fragen PN - No PN please
I won't answer to unfriendly users any more. A greeting and regards are just polite.
OTRS 8 auf Debian 11 (Test)
Znuny 7.x latest version testing auf Debian 11
-- Ich beantworte keine Forums-Fragen PN - No PN please
I won't answer to unfriendly users any more. A greeting and regards are just polite.